    Reconstruction and identification of pairs of collimated τ-leptons decaying hadronically using √s = 13 TeV ppcollision data with the ATLAS detector

    No full text
    This paper describes an algorithm for reconstructing and identifying a highly collimated hadronically decaying τ -lepton pair with low transverse momentum. When two τ -leptons are highly collimated, their visible decay products might overlap, degrading the reconstruction performance for each of the τ -leptons. A dedicated treatment attempting to tag the τ -lepton pair as a single object is required. The reconstruction algorithm is based on a large radius jet and its associated two leading subjets, and the identification uses a boosted decision tree to discriminate between signatures from τ + τ - systems and those arising from QCD jets. The efficiency of the identification algorithm is measured in Z γ events using proton–proton collision data at s = 13 TeV collected by the ATLAS experiment at the Large Hadron Collider between 2015 and 2018, corresponding to an integrated luminosity of 139 fb - 1 . The resulting data-to-simulation scale factors are close to unity with uncertainties ranging from 26 to 37%

    Conjunto de datos: Reporte compromisos y cumplimiento de promesas en materia ambiental 2018-2022: “pasando el testimonio” entre las administraciones Piñera – Boric

    No full text
    La base de datos contiene los compromisos presidenciales de relevancia ambiental establecidos en el programa de gobierno y cuentas públicas (2018, 2019, 2020 y 2021) del Presidente Sebastián Piñera, su nivel de cumplimiento y las respuestas de política pública dadas a estos compromisos en los cuatro años de gobierno (entre 2018 y 2022). Además, sistematiza los compromisos de relevancia ambiental del Presidente Gabriel Boric presentados en su programa de gobierno (2022-2026).202

    Newborn screening for primary congenital hypothyroidism: past, present and future

    No full text
    This manuscript reviews the evolution of newborn screening for primary congenital hypothyroidism (CH) and explores future strategies to enhance diagnostic accuracy. Over the past few decades, newborn screening has expanded globally, significantly reducing the incidence of severe forms of the disease. However, challenges persist, especially regarding the overdiagnosis of mild cases of primary CH, which may not require treatment. Omic sciences may help researchers to enhance the understanding of primary CH and to uncover new biomarkers to identify mild cases with altered proteomic and/or metabolic profiles associated with the need for treatment. Record-linkage studies can help deepen knowledge on the long-term outcomes of affected children identified through newborn screening. Nevertheless, despite 50 years of newborn screening for primary CH, a minority of newborns currently benefit from this critically important public health intervention. Efforts should be done to expand access to newborn screening globally, especially for those born in developing countries

    Structural control on the Southern Andean Nevados de Chillán Geothermal System

    No full text
    Detailed structural analysis from representative outcrops is necessary to characterize geothermal reservoir dynamics. Here, we estimate fracture density and intensity, as well as the dimensional properties of individual fault and fracture sets in basement rocks of the Nevados de Chillán Geothermal System. We identified several important structural features that could be responsible for controlling local fluid flow; the high-angle sinistral Las Trancas Fault as well as a series of low-angle reverse faults within the Las Termas-Olla de Mote Fault system. Most fractures identified strike either NE-SW, NNE-SSW, and NNW-SSE. Analysis of fault-slip data, supported by seismicity, indicates the presence of a main transtensional regime with subhorizontal NE-trending σ1. Structures sub-parallel to the present-day local maximum horizontal stress show significant dilation tendencies, whilst NW-SE fractures are less prone to dilation. NE and E-W high angle faults could be primary conduits facilitating the upward migration of hot fluids from reservoirs within crystalline and fractured rocks. The fracture length distribution was analysed using power law, negative exponential, and log-normal distribution. The power law with a scaling exponent of about −3 provides the best fit to the data.     Reporte legislativo No. 4 Legislatura 372 / 11 de Marzo 2024-10 de Marzo 2025. Observatorio de Políticas Públicas. Legislación relevante en pesca artesanal, acuicultura y desarrollo costero

    No full text
    Este reporte del Observatorio de Políticas Públicas de SECOS analiza el trabajo legislativo relevante para la pesca artesanal, acuicultura y desarrollo costero en la legislatura 372. Se ingresaron 19 proyectos de ley, destacando la reforma a la Ley de Pesca (boletín 17095-21), normativas sobre buceo y transferencia tecnológica. Se votaron 11 proyectos y se promulgaron 3 leyes, incluyendo avances en equidad de género. Con más de 75 sesiones y 774 invitados en la Comisión de Pesca, se confirma la magnitud del debate sobre la nueva Ley de Pesca.     The Construction of a Segregated Metropolis: Urban Segregation and Natural Preexistences in the Metropolitan Area of Concepción

    No full text
    Urban segregation has been the center of discussion in various theories of urban sociology (Ruiz-Tagle, 2016), gaining great importance in recent years. The problem has been mainly addressed from residential location and socioeconomic stratification, although there are other factors that can complement its understanding and representation. Among them, the level of Segregation according to socioeconomic level and its representation in Space (Trufello et al., North Grande Geography Journal 160:81–131, 2022) play a key role in the construction of an area in the process of metropolitanization. This article seeks to observe the way in which Segregation has been constructed and evolved in the Metropolitan Area of Concepción (AMC) from its representation in Space. Using a quantitative methodology, first, homogeneous areas are constructed regarding territorial segregation attributes in the AMC from the geolocation of an entropy index and socioeconomic variables. Second, typologies of urban environments are constructed considering the natural preexistences in the territory. These data are processed through spatial statistics from the regionalization method and its cartographic representation. The results contribute to understanding socio-spatial segregation from its representation in space at the metropolitan level.     Psychosocial and vulnerability factors affecting well-being of migrant mothers from Latin America: A scoping review

    No full text
    This scoping review examines the experiences of migrant mothers from Latin America, highlighting psychosocial and vulnerability factors affecting their well-being in migration contexts. Focusing on south-to-south migration and the gendered experiences of caregiving women, it addresses a significant gap in the literature. Findings reveal unique challenges such as acculturation stress, economic hardships, limited social support, and mental health issues exacerbated by marginalization due to caregiving roles. Practice implications for social work and policy include culturally competent interventions and the design of supportive policies tailored to migrant mothers’ needs

    Streaming Enumeration on Nested Documents

    No full text
    Some of the most relevant document schemas used online, such as XML and JSON, have a nested format. In the past decade, the task of extracting data from nested documents over streams has become especially relevant. We focus on the streaming evaluation of queries with outputs of varied sizes over nested documents. We model queries of this kind as Visibly Pushdown Annotators (VPAnn), a computational model that extends visibly pushdown automata with outputs and has the same expressive power as monadic second-order logic over nested documents. Since processing a document through a VPAnn can generate a massive number of results, we are interested in reading the input in a streaming fashion and enumerating the outputs one after another as efficiently as possible, namely, with constant delay. This article presents an algorithm that enumerates these elements with constant delay after processing the document stream in a single pass. Furthermore, we show that this algorithm is worst-case optimal in terms of update-time per symbol and memory usage

    Experimental and Numerical Assessment of the In-Plane Behaviour of PG-RM Walls with Openings

    No full text
    This paper investigates how openings affect the in-plane response of partially grouted masonry (PG-RM) walls. The effect of the openings was assessed regarding shear capacity and failure mode through the cyclic test of four façadetype walls constructed with different opening sizes and with and without asymmetry. The results show that the shear capacity decreases with the opening’s height or width increment. It is also observed that geometric asymmetry generates differences between the lateral resistances of both in-plane loading directions. In addition, a two-dimensional finite element macro model using Abaqus was validated against the experimental results. The numerical strategy implemented satisfactorily represented the shear strength and failure mode of the tested walls.
